Definitions:

Normal Curve

A bell-shaped curve that represents the distribution of a set of data where most occurrences take place in the middle, near the average.

Bell-Shaped Distribution

A graphical representation of data that displays a normal distribution, which appears as a symmetrical bell-shaped curve.

Random Samples

A selection method used in research to gather participants from a larger population in a way that each individual has an equal chance of being chosen.

Population Averages

Statistical measures that summarize the central tendency of a collection of data, representing the average characteristics of a population.
